Output 95dd1a04f98bcfd7d63cf0239dab5cccf465559fd1d27d0f60e2620f22569f08:0

value
678736
script pubkey
OP_0 OP_PUSHBYTES_20 8a22ece259ccae7ca3a0ce10e8c02a417eaad45a
address
bc1q3g3wecjeejh8egaqecgw3sp2g9l244z656tmr9
transaction
95dd1a04f98bcfd7d63cf0239dab5cccf465559fd1d27d0f60e2620f22569f08
spent
true